Brees’ five 5,000-yard seasons all rank in the top 11 all time.īrees also has been the unquestioned face of the franchise and leader in the locker room throughout his time in New Orleans. That mark ranks second all time, one yard behind Peyton Manning’s 5,477 yards with Denver in 2013. Payton’s offenses were more passing oriented in some seasons than others for a variety of reasons related to personnel, the types of defenses the Saints faced and the way games played out.īut when Brees had to throw, he piled up yardage whether the Saints were a playoff team or not.īrees eclipsed the 5,000-yard mark in five seasons, with his career-best 5,476 yards coming in 2011. His 70.5% rate in 2020 ranked ninth all time, giving Brees six of the top nine season completion rates in NFL history. Indeed, a hallmark of Brees’ career has been his decision-making, timing and accuracy.īrees not only holds the NFL’s single-season record for completion rate at 74.4% in 2018, but also holds the second-highest mark at 74.3 in 2019 and third-highest at 72% in 2017. The franchise’s only Super Bowl appearance and championship came in the 2009 season, with Brees, selected as the game’s MVP, memorably celebrating with first child Baylen in his arms as confetti floated around them.īrees’ 32 completions (on 39 attempts) tied a Super Bowl record, just one of numerous times the 6-foot-1 quarterback, drafted by the San Diego Chargers out of Purdue in the beginning of the second round of the 2001 draft, etched his name in NFL record books. That would be the first of nine seasons in which Brees led the Saints to the playoffs. One season later, with then-first-year coach Sean Payton calling plays and Brees executing them, the Saints won 10 regular-season games and a divisional-round playoff game in a rebuilt Superdome - a storybook run that didn’t end until a loss in Chicago in New Orleans’ first ever NFC championship game. The storm had forced the Saints to play all of their 2005 games outside New Orleans, and the Saints finished that season 3-13. When Brees moved to New Orleans, he bought and renovated a historic home in the city’s Uptown neighborhood, just a block away from Audubon Park. He joined the Saints shortly after, at a time when New Orleans was still coping with widespread devastation caused by Hurricane Katrina in August 2005. His retirement brings an end to a career that came to embody resilience and renewal on multiple levels.īrees’ most prolific seasons came after he underwent major reconstructive surgery in early 2006 to repair a career-threatening throwing shoulder injury.

While Brees had dropped hints about his intentions, saying he considered himself to be on “borrowed time,” he declined to confirm his plans until now. Brees’ 571 career touchdown passes rank second behind Brady’s 581. “He’s as courageous and as tough a player as I’ve ever been around.”īrees is the NFL’s all-time leader in yards passing with 80,358, although that mark will be under threat next season by 44-year-old Tom Brady, who has 79,204 career yards passing. I can recall so many of these different injuries,” Payton said. “Over the years his durability and availability is quite amazing. Saints coach Sean Payton said Brees had plenty of other injuries or ailments during his Saints tenure, but willed himself to play through them whenever possible.
